On September 10, 2026, Runway simultaneously released its new flagship video-generation AI, "Gen-4," for both the API and Runway Studio. It comes standard with temporal consistency of up to 240 seconds (4 minutes) and "Cine Control," a 6-degrees-of-freedom camera path system. The API price of $0.06/second represents approximately a 40% reduction compared to the previous generation, Gen-3 Alpha — a level at which, for the first time, economic viability for full production use beyond mere prototyping appears to have been established.

Since Gen-3 Alpha launched in June 2024, its maximum duration limit and low character consistency have blocked adoption in professional video production. From 2025 onward, OpenAI's "Sora 2" and Google's "Veo 3" entered the market with longer durations and higher resolutions, and the commercial use of AI-generated video expanded rapidly. A July 2026 survey of 412 video production companies found that 43% said they would "incorporate AI video into live production projects by the end of 2026."
With Gen-4, Runway set a higher target: replacing the production workflow itself, which has traditionally assumed live-action shoots with talent and locations. The substantial price reduction is seen less as a response to price competition with two rivals and more as a strategic decision to eliminate the psychological and financial barriers to "full production adoption" by production companies.
The duration now allows a 30-second TV commercial or a 60-second digital ad to be generated in one continuous pass. With the previous 10–20 second limit, the assumption was "shot-by-shot asset generation + manual editing," but at 240 seconds, "scene-level generation" becomes a reality, fundamentally changing how directors and AI divide responsibilities.
The 6-degrees-of-freedom parameters allow numerical specification of "distance maintenance from subject," "pan speed," and "timing of push-in and pull-out." A "language" for conveying a director of photography's intent to the AI is being established, and the industry has entered a phase where the collaborative model between human camera operators and AI is being called into question.
Generating 30 seconds of footage costs roughly $1.80. Compared to location fees, studio costs, and talent fees, the economic case is clearly established at least for prototyping and storyboard validation. The distance to the threshold of full production adoption now depends more on legal risk than on quality.
OpenAI Sora 2 and Google Veo 3 each claim advantages in quality and platform integration, respectively. Runway differentiates itself on "ease of integration into production workflows" through vertical integration of its API and Runway Studio. The three-way competitive structure is expected to solidify within 2026.
Runway continues to keep the details of its training data private, and reports indicate that inquiries from video industry associations are ongoing. Companies considering commercial adoption will need to conduct legal due diligence in parallel.
